For many months now the tram stops at the Broadwater stop in Fleetwood have been in disrepair. The vandalism on the roof and side panels meant that people had no shelter from the elements.

Unfortunately this was difficult to solve as I was passed from pillar to post in finding who had responsibility to do this, with Blackpool Transport and Lancashire County Council each pointing me in the direction of the other.

But I am pleased to report that after months of pushing, I have been successful on working with Blackpool Transport and Blackpool Council to secure the necessary funding for repairs, and a new tram stop has finally been installed.

I’m delighted that we have been able to get this done. King George’s playing field is a place where families come together on big sporting days, and to see our tram stops in such a state gives a really poor first impression of the town, which is why I’m so glad we’ve now got this fixed.

I’ve been busy working in this area for many months now, as last year I was pleased to support local businesses and residents to successfully get Fleetwood Road repainted, as this was causing confusion and deterring customer parking at the busy Broadwater junction, and then a few months on successfully get the light signalling fixed at the same junction as the sequencing was giving priority to smaller roads which led to huge build-ups of traffic on Fleetwood Road.
